Why Akogrimo? - Grid and Networks – not a business proposition yet Grid Middleware is network agnostic – the net is simply there Grid Middleware is unaware of Mobility and Pervasiveness Grid Middleware ignores cross- layer cooperation in modern networks Grid Middleware is not prepared for the network revolution Grid is not interesting for network operators – no business model for them. And so …. To join Grid Middleware and The mobile Internet of tomorrow …. The Internet The mobile Internet of tomorrow GRID Middleware (GLOBUS, EDG, UNICORE, OGSI.NET, …)

5 Advanced Grid Research Workshops through European and Asian Co-operation 5 Vision Grid services: –To be pervasive Anyone, anywhere, any time fixed or mobile –personalised knowledge and semantics –To allow for: Ad hoc, dynamic and cross-organisational federations –To solve complex scenarios in everyday life For network and service operators: –To extend their scope by developing new, business services and value added chains.

10 Advanced Grid Research Workshops through European and Asian Co-operation 10 Challenges of eLearning field trip Grids: –On demand formation of student groups –Sharing of data from several separately administered sources securely –Common agreed interfaces for diverse equipment Mobility: –Changing physical location of student nodes –Mobile sensors and receipt of multimedia –Relocation of some higher Grid services from fixed to mobile equipment

11 Advanced Grid Research Workshops through European and Asian Co-operation 11 eHealth testbed - more detail on this Early recognition of heart attacks or strokes and provision of proper treatment as soon as possible –So, monitor patients with a risk of heart attack or stroke. –Activate emergency when required, along with monitoring history In more detail: –Patient at risk has monitoring equipment communicating with mobile –Patient is registered with heart monitoring and emergency service (HMES) –Locate and direct emergency forces or first responders nearby to the patient –Collect, analyze and interpret patient data before arrival in hospital –Enable access and intelligent filtering of patient records –Combine in an intelligent way live data (e.g. cardiograms) with patient history and simulations –Dynamic Workflows based on results or human intervention –Services range from information retrieval over computational analysis service to information interpretation and filtering.

14 Advanced Grid Research Workshops through European and Asian Co-operation 14 Challenges from eHealth test bed - a selection Grids: –Creation of VO on demand –Integration of patient data from multiple separately administered sources securely –Multiple autonomous conventional organisations –Services from several conventional organisations Mobility: –Monitoring of patients at risk wherever they are –Patients electronic smart card –Access to experts knowledge whereever they are –Access to equipment in the emergency vehicle

16 Advanced Grid Research Workshops through European and Asian Co-operation 16 Selected technical considerations Operational VO on demand for running workflows: inherits providers, roles, responsibilities, rights and restrictions already set up in parent VO. Service discovery and negotiation within workflow execution timeframe Policies for VO Management, SLA, security Security at Grid level to interwork with A4C Signalling and message delivery both available Presence detection Context determination (on next slide) Mobile IPv6: allows roaming with minimal disruption

17 Advanced Grid Research Workshops through European and Asian Co-operation 17 Examples of Context #User: –Profile: e.g. contact details, preferences –Current role –Presence –Location Locally available services: Device: –Screen –OS –Installed s/w Context may influence workflow behaviour
